近年來,混沌工程工具市場規模呈現強勁成長,從2024年的19.5億美元成長到2025年的21.3億美元,複合年成長率達9.2%。這一成長主要歸功於雲端運算、容器化、對服務可靠性的日益重視、持續部署實踐的採用、日益成長的安全問題、成本削減措施以及數位轉型舉措。

預計未來幾年混沌工程工具市場規模將強勁成長,到2029年將達到29.8億美元,複合年成長率(CAGR)為8.8%。預測期內的成長可歸因於多種因素,例如DevOps和敏捷實踐的普及、風險管理意識的增強、現代系統複雜性的增加、數位轉型速度的加快以及對雲端原生基礎設施的需求。預測期內的關鍵趨勢包括技術進步、混沌工程工具的創新、新興技術、企業環境的發展、以及研發活動的推進。

混沌工程工具是專門設計的軟體應用程式和平台,用於執行混沌實驗並觀察系統在各種故障場景下的行為。這些工具提供了一個嚴格控制和編配的環境,使用戶能夠有條不紊地部署混沌實驗並全面評估系統響應。

混沌工程工具的主要組成部分是解決方案和服務。混沌工程解決方案由精心設計的軟體工具和公共雲端組成,旨在支援混沌工程實踐。這些解決方案部署在公有雲和私有雲環境中,用於執行效能和可擴展性測試、故障注入和測試、彈性測試、災難復原測試以及安全私有雲端測試。這些解決方案廣泛應用於各個行業,包括銀行、金融服務和保險 (BFSI)、資訊科技 (IT) 和 IT 服務、通訊、製造業、零售和電子商務、媒體和娛樂、醫療保健和生命科學以及許多其他垂直行業。

混沌工程工具市場將因數位轉型加速並席捲各行各業而成長。數位轉型以將數位技術融入業務營運為特徵,其驅動力來自技術的快速發展、消費行為的改變、數據的廣泛可用性以及先進的分析工具。這種加速發展凸顯了對彈性可靠的數位系統的需求,並將混沌工程工具定位為企業數位化韌性策略的重要組成部分。例如,國際商業機器公司 (IBM) 於 2024 年 1 月進行的一項調查數據顯示,大型企業的 IT 專業人員對人工智慧 (AI) 的採用和探索顯著成長,這凸顯了技術進步以及對強大數位系統以推動數位轉型的必要性。

為了保持競爭力,混沌工程工具市場的主要企業正積極推動技術創新。 LitmusChaos 2.13.0 就是一個顯著的例子。 LitmusChaos 是開放原始碼的混沌工程平台,旨在透過誘發混沌來識別基礎設施的弱點和潛在的故障。該平台由 LitmusChaos 社群於 2022 年 9 月發布,支援雲端原生基礎設施和應用程式,並以其易用性和對現代混沌工程實踐的遵循而著稱。 LitmusChaos 2.13.0 引入了多項更新,包括架構增強、用戶指南、最新混沌實驗的詳細資訊、自定義資源模式規範以及全面的常見問題解答和故障排除資訊,從而提升了功能和用戶體驗。

2022年3月,Harness策略性地收購了ChaosNative,標誌著混沌工程流程在軟體交付生命週期(SDLC)中向前邁進。此舉旨在透過在開發早期階段整合混沌工程,改善開發者體驗,並釋放更多時間用於創新。此外,Harness也成為CNCF LitmusChaos計劃的主要贊助商,承諾進一步支持開放原始碼專案。 ChaosNative在雲端原生混沌工程方面的專業知識與Harness的目標高度契合,並鞏固了Harness在混沌工程工具市場引領創新的地位。

Chaos engineering tools are specialized software applications or platforms engineered to enable the execution of chaos experiments and the observation of system behavior across diverse failure scenarios. These tools furnish a meticulously controlled and orchestrated environment, allowing users to introduce chaos experiments methodically and assess the system's response comprehensively.

The primary components of chaos engineering tools consist of solutions and services. Chaos engineering solutions comprise software tools or platforms meticulously crafted to enable the implementation of chaos engineering practices. These solutions are deployed across public and private cloud environments to conduct fault injection and testing, resilience testing and disaster recovery, security resilience testing, as well as performance and scalability testing. They find application across a broad spectrum of industries including banking, financial services, and insurance (BFSI), information technology (IT) and IT-enabled services, telecommunications, manufacturing, retail and e-commerce, media and entertainment, healthcare and life sciences, and various other verticals.

The chaos engineering tools market size has grown strongly in recent years. It will grow from $1.95 billion in 2024 to $2.13 billion in 2025 at a compound annual growth rate (CAGR) of 9.2%. The growth in the historic period can be attributed to cloud computing, and containerization, growing emphasis on service reliability, adoption of continuous deployment practices, heightened security concerns, cost reduction efforts and digital transformation initiatives.

The chaos engineering tools market size is expected to see strong growth in the next few years. It will grow to $2.98 billion in 2029 at a compound annual growth rate (CAGR) of 8.8%. The growth in the forecast period can be attributed to adoption of DevOps and Agile practices, rising awareness of risk management, increasing complexity in modern systems, high rate of digital transformation, demand for cloud-native infrastructures. Major trends in the forecast period include growing technological advancements, innovation for chaos engineering tools, upcoming technologies, developing corporate landscape, research and development activities.

Key players in the chaos engineering tools market are driving innovation to maintain a competitive edge. One notable example is LitmusChaos version 2.13.0, an open-source Chaos Engineering platform developed to identify infrastructure weaknesses and potential outages by inducing chaos. Released by the LitmusChaos community in September 2022, this platform caters to cloud-native infrastructure and applications, boasting ease of use and adherence to modern chaos engineering practices. LitmusChaos version 2.13.0 introduces various updates, including architectural enhancements, user guides, latest chaos experiment details, custom resource schema specifications, and comprehensive FAQs and troubleshooting information, enhancing its functionality and user experience.

In March 2022, Harness Inc. strategically acquired ChaosNative, signaling a shift in the chaos engineering process earlier in the software delivery lifecycle (SDLC). This move aims to improve the developer experience and allocate more time for innovation by integrating chaos engineering into earlier stages of development. Additionally, Harness Inc. pledges to become a primary sponsor of the CNCF LitmusChaos project and offer increased support for the open-source initiative. ChaosNative's expertise in cloud-native chaos engineering aligns with Harness Inc.'s objectives, fortifying their position in driving innovation within the chaos engineering tools market.
